/* sysLib.c - Samsung SNDS100 system-dependent routines */

#include "copyright_wrs.h"

/*
modification history
--------------------
01b,25nov99,knp changed name "end" to "secEnd"
01a,26aug99,ak/knp adapted for Samsung's snds100 board
*/

/*
DESCRIPTION
This library provides board-specific routines for the Samsung SNDS100
Ver 1.0 Development Board BSP.

It #includes the following chip drivers:
    nullVme.c -         dummy VMEbus routines
    sndsTimer.c -       SNDS timer driver
    sndsIntrCtl.c -     SNDS interrupt controller driver
    nullNvRam.c -	dummy NVRAM routines

It #includes the following BSP files:
    sysSerial.c -	serial device initialisation routines
    sysEnd.c -		END network driver support routines.

INCLUDE FILES: sysLib.h string.h intLib.h taskLib.h vxLib.h muxLib.h

SEE ALSO:
.pG "Configuration"
.I "ARM Architecture Reference Manual,"
.I "Samsung KS32C50100 Microcontroller User's Manual,"
.I "Samsung KS32C5000(A)/50100 Microcontroller Application Notes."
*/

/*******************************************************************************
*
* sysModel - return the model name of the CPU board
*
* This routine returns the model name of the CPU board.
* 
* RETURNS: A pointer to a string identifying the board and CPU.
*/

char *sysModel (void)
    {
#if	(CPU == ARM7TDMI_T)
    return	"ARM PID - ARM7TDMI (Thumb)";
#elif	(CPU == ARM7TDMI)
    return	"KS32C50100 FOR SNDS100 Ver 1.0";
#elif	(CPU == ARM710A)
    return	"ARM PID - ARM710A";
#endif	/* (CPU == ARM7TDMI_T) */
    }

/*******************************************************************************
*
* sysBspRev - return the bsp version with the revision eg 1.1/<x>
*
* This function returns a pointer to a bsp version with the revision.
* for eg. 1.1/<x>. BSP_REV is concatanated to BSP_VERSION to form the
* BSP identification string.
*
* RETURNS: A pointer to the BSP version/revision string.
*/

char * sysBspRev (void)
    {
    return (BSP_VERSION BSP_REV);
    }

/*******************************************************************************
*
* sysHwInit - initialize the CPU board hardware
*
* This routine initializes various features of the hardware.
* Normally, it is called from usrInit() in usrConfig.c.
*
* NOTE: This routine should not be called directly by the user.
*
* RETURNS: N/A
*/

void sysHwInit (void)
    {
    /* install the IRQ/SVC interrupt stack splitting routine */

    _func_armIntStackSplit = sysIntStackSplit;

#ifdef  INCLUDE_CACHE_SUPPORT
    sndsCacheEnable(SNDS_CACHE_8K);		/* enable  cache */
#endif	/* INCLUDE_CACHE_ENABLE */

    sysSerialHwInit ();      /* initialise serial data structure */
	sndsIICDevInit();
    }

/*******************************************************************************
*
* sysHwInit2 - additional system configuration and initialization
*
* This routine connects system interrupts and does any additional
* configuration necessary.
*
* RETURNS: N/A
*
* NOMANUAL
*
* Note: this is called from sysClkConnect() in the timer driver.
*/

void sysHwInit2 (void)
    {
    /* initialise the interrupt library and interrupt driver */

    intLibInit (SNDS_INT_NUM_LEVELS, SNDS_INT_NUM_LEVELS, INT_MODE);
    sndsIntDevInit();

    /* connect sys clock interrupt and auxiliary clock interrupt */

    (void)intConnect (INUM_TO_IVEC (INT_VEC_TIMER0), sysClkInt, 0);
    (void)intConnect (INUM_TO_IVEC (INT_VEC_TIMER1), sysAuxClkInt, 0);

    /* connect serial interrupt */
    sysSerialHwInit2();
	sndsIICDevInit2();
    }
